We have used Blue Water Safari through the cruise ship excursions last year and had a fabulous time on the catamaran trip. We were on this tour , (2/5//18) and were disappointed from the beginning. Nevis Beach Getaway The meeting place was easy to find and there was a representative from Blue Safari that took our tickets, and that was the last we saw of anyone from Blue Safari. As we were moved over to get on a water taxi, it was brought up that we were to be on a catamaran and was told that Blue Safari overbooked. We were not given an option to get our money back, just that they were overbooked and this is what we were to get. We took the Public water taxi over to Nevis and had no idea from there what to do, We were not left at a beach, but left at the water taxi dock. Finally, we were told to get into a Taxi. We were not even sure where we were going. We got into a taxi and then brought to a beach. Again, no further instructions other then be ready by 3:30pm. The beach was far from what was described on the website description... " With mile after mile of superb white sand and a beguiling array of options for eating and drinking, Pinney's is not only recognized as one of the finest beaches in the Leeward chain of islands, it's one of best in the entire Caribbean." The beach was a dirt beach, there was broken glass, debris and condoms. The water was murky, not the beautiful water as described. This was by far the worst beach we have ever been to in our 25 Caribbean cruises. We were not given even a drink as described. We were abandon there for 4 hours, in down pours and thunder storms. We were not given any contact info. We were concerned we would make it back to the port in time to get our ship. We had to ask to people at the bar to see if they could reach out to the cab company that left us here, if they knew anything about us getting picked up. There we no other public water taxis going back to the island of St Kitts that day. Finally, there was a power boat that pulled up, at 3:45 pm. we had to get into the water and then climb up on the boat. There was a women there who had a very difficult time getting onto the power boat. Again, not the smooth ride on a catamaran that we were promised in the description on the website. We paid $98 up front prior to getting to St Kitts, and did not get what we were promised. We emailed Blue Waters Safari 2/10/18 - they responded quickly with " we hired a subcontractor for this tour who then hired another contractor without our knowledge and hence the reason for the misinformation." "In regards to Pinney's beach, it is one of the best beaches on the island and is known for having clear waters and white sand, we have been experiencing some very windy conditions lately and that may be the reason for the poor visibility and bad water conditions, We do apologize again for the unpleasant experience." I am not sure how windy weather would turn white sand beaches into black dirt????? I would not recommend this tour company, we were very disappointed with their response to our email, they took no responsibility or action to correct it. We gave them a chance to right a wrong.
